SONG MEANING

“Hola” is the soundtrack of a spontaneous late-night hookup, painted with the vibrant colors of reggaetón culture. Rauw Alejandro, alongside Darell and Valentino, tells the story of an ex-lover who dials him up after midnight, catching him a little tipsy and very much still attracted. The phone rings, the word hola hangs in the air, and suddenly both sides are confessing the spark that never really faded. They flirt, negotiate where to meet, tease each other through video calls, and celebrate the thrill of secrecy — all while promising a night that starts at 2 a.m. and might never truly end.

Beneath the playful lyrics and irresistible beat lies a modern take on desire: social-media scouting, late-night “booty calls,” and the irresistible pull of chemistry that ignores the clock. The song captures that electric moment when past feelings collide with present temptation, turning a simple greeting into an open invitation for passion, adventure, and a little bit of trouble.
